In today's dynamic marketplace, businesses are constantly seeking to improve their operational efficiency and furnish exceptional customer experiences. Supply chain collaboration has emerged as a strategic factor in achieving these goals. By fostering tight relationships with suppliers, manufacturers, distributors, and retailers, companies can streamline their supply chain processes, driving to significant performance advancements. A collaborative approach promotes information exchange, enabling all stakeholders to have a shared view of the network. This, in turn, minimizes delays, enhances inventory management, and optimizes order fulfillment.

  • Specifically, collaborative planning, forecasting, and replenishment (CPFR) initiatives can enable firms to accurately forecast demand and coordinate production schedules with actual customer needs.
  • Moreover, collaborative logistics solutions can leverage technology to optimize transportation routes, reduce delivery times, and decrease shipping costs.
  • Ultimately, supply chain collaboration is not merely a practice but a essential business strategy that can accelerate sustainable growth and market success.

Real-World Examples of Successful Supply Chain Collaboration

Supply logistics collaboration has become vital for businesses to thrive in today's dynamic market. Numerous real-world examples showcase the immense benefits of seamless communication and coordination between suppliers.

For instance, businesses like Walmart have built robust relationships with their suppliers, enabling them to optimize inventory management and reduce delivery times. This collaborative approach has resulted in improved customer satisfaction and a strategic advantage.

Similarly, the automotive industry exemplifies successful supply chain collaboration through joint programs. Manufacturers often work closely with their component suppliers to develop innovative products and streamline production processes. This cooperation leads to faster time-to-market, reduced costs, and improved product quality.
